What Bangladeshi applicants need to get right
Bangladeshi passport holders submit Schengen short-stay applications primarily through VFS Global centres in Dhaka, with select missions also reachable via VFS Chittagong. Italian, German, French, and Spanish missions carry most of the volume, and slots tighten sharply between May and September — especially for Italy, which sees heavy family-visit and seasonal-work-related travel volume.
Three documents drive most refusals filed from Bangladesh: a generic cover letter that doesn't anchor the trip to a clear return reason in Bangladesh, financials that don't reconcile with the itinerary, and missing employer paperwork. Salaried applicants are expected to attach a No Objection Certificate (NOC) on company letterhead with NID copy, the last six months of statements from Dutch-Bangla Bank, BRAC Bank, or Eastern Bank, and the latest NBR e-TIN return acknowledgement. Self-employed applicants substitute the NOC with a Trade Licence and the same tax record set.
Financial proof is read as a coherent story across the last six months of Bangladeshi bank statements. Consulates compare the daily budget on your itinerary against closing BDT balances and against the salary credits visible on those statements at a realistic euro rate. Frequently asked questions
- Where do I apply for a Schengen visa in Bangladesh?
- Most missions route through VFS Global in Dhaka (Delta Life Tower, Gulshan) with select missions also reachable via VFS Chittagong. Italian, German, French, Spanish, and Dutch consulates all use VFS as their submission centre. Always apply to the consulate of your main destination by nights spent.
- How many months of bank statements do Bangladeshi applicants need?
- Six months is the practical minimum at most VFS Dhaka submissions — Italian and Spanish consulates in particular scrutinise the closing balance trend and salary credit pattern across the full six-month window. Statements should be stamped by your bank or downloaded directly from internet banking with the bank's official header.
- Do I need an NBR e-TIN return for a Schengen visa?
- Yes, where applicable. The most recent e-TIN return acknowledgement is part of the standard documentation alongside the employer NOC and bank statements. The tax record is the consulate's cross-check on the income stated in your employment or business documents.
- How long does my Bangladeshi passport need to be valid?
- Your passport must be valid for at least three months beyond your planned date of return from the Schengen area, with at least two blank pages, and issued within the last ten years. Applying close to the three-month margin raises the risk of refusal regardless of the rest of the file.
